  • Patent number: 10263973
    Abstract: A first device generates a first signature by using complete transaction data received from a second device, a first algorithm and a first key, modifies at least one character from the complete transaction data and gets partial transaction data, and sends to the second device the partial transaction data. The second device requests a user to modify the partial transaction data by providing at least one character, as complementary data to the partial transaction data, gets, as request response from a user, at least one character to modify the partial transaction data, a corresponding result being proposed modified transaction data, generates a second signature by using the proposed modified transaction data, the first algorithm and the first key, and sends to the first device the second signature. Only if the second signature does match the first signature, then the first device authorizes to carry out a corresponding transaction.

  • Patent number: 8555496
    Abstract: The invention relates to a method for manufacturing a USB electronic key, whereby a chip is cut out of a tape, provided with a plurality of chips, each chip defining contact pads in USB format and supporting an electronic component, connected to the pads. The thickness adjustment step is directly carried out on the chip to give a thickness conforming to the USB standard, at least in the area of the contact pads.

  • Patent number: 7975915
    Abstract: The invention concerns a USB-key type electronic device (73) comprising an electronic circuit mounted on a support (60), a gripping element showing a graphic print and/or customization (p), a protective case (70) arranged at the element so as to cause the graphic print and/or customization to be visible through the case. The invention is characterized in that the graphic print and/or customization is produced on the support (60) bearing the electronic circuit, and in that the case covers directly said support (60). The invention also concerns a method including the following steps: producing an electronic circuit support in the form of a printed smart card with contacts in conformity with the USB standard, producing a graphic customization on a support surface, protecting said graphic customization with a transparent protective shell.

  • Publication number: 20080296606
    Abstract: The invention generally relates to devices comprising semiconductor chips. More specifically, the invention relates to an electronic module (1) comprising at least one integrated circuit chip (10) which is connected to the conductor tracks of an insulating support and at least one light-emitting diode (16). According to one aspect of the invention, the assembly formed by the integrated circuit (10) and the light-emitting diode (16) is coated with a translucent resin (32), thereby forming an element for the mechanical protection of the assembly and for the transmission of the light emitted by the diode (16). According to another aspect of the invention, the coated assembly comprises at least one indicator light (LED) and a radio-frequency coil (preferably in the module).

  • Patent number: 6669096
    Abstract: Smart card readers dedicated to a particular application use both a microcontroller whose read only memory determines the running of the application, and a security component executing, under the control of the microcontroller, subroutines related to the security of the application (authentication, confidential programs, etc.). So that the manager of the application can have access to certain memory areas of the security component, provision is made for the microcontroller to be able to pass automatically to a so-called “transparent” mode, when a specific access code issued by a test card is recognized. In this mode, the read or write instructions for a memory area, issued by the test card, are interpreted by the microcontroller as being read or write instructions for a memory area of the security component rather than the microcontroller.

  • Patent number: 5327018
    Abstract: The invention concerns interface circuits for chip card readers. It consists of providing link connections between this circuit and the reader, these connections being identical to those established between the circuit and the chip card. An internal switch (102) in the circuit is used to link these connections together, or to a control register (101), which is internal to the circuit, and actuated by an additional control connection. With the invention, it is possible to limit the number of connections between the circuit and the reader and to control the circuit with a software interface which is identical to the control interface of a chip card.

  • Patent number: 5212369
    Abstract: The method of loading applications programs into a memory card reader having a microprocessor, connected by telephone to a server center, and suitable for executing these applications is such that the applications programs are stored in the memories of cards entitled to said applications while corresponding application pointers are stored in the server center, with the method consisting, once a card has been inserted in the reader, in setting up a telephone call from the reader to the server, in transferring the pointer for the application requested by the reader over the telephone line, in the reader interpreting the pointer to find the corresponding application program in the card, and then in transferring the program very quickly to the reader for the purpose of executing it. The invention applies in particular to those applications programs which are run most frequently from a memory card.
